国产aaaa级全身裸体精油片_337p人体粉嫩久久久红粉影视_一区中文字幕在线观看_国产亚洲精品一区二区_欧美裸体男粗大1609_午夜亚洲激情电影av_黄色小说入口_日本精品久久久久中文字幕_少妇思春三a级_亚洲视频自拍偷拍

首頁(yè) > 化工知識(shí) > 坦白說(shuō),這個(gè)函數(shù)的神奇功能,連VBA都羨慕!

坦白說(shuō),這個(gè)函數(shù)的神奇功能,連VBA都羨慕!

時(shí)間:2021-10-31 來(lái)源: 瀏覽:

坦白說(shuō),這個(gè)函數(shù)的神奇功能,連VBA都羨慕!

原創(chuàng) EH看見(jiàn)星光 Excel星球
Excel星球

AhaExcel

建議常用Excel的職場(chǎng)人關(guān)注,海量教程隨學(xué)隨用,隨用隨查。 主創(chuàng):看見(jiàn)星光,微軟全球最有價(jià)值專家、Excel圖書作者、培訓(xùn)師。 內(nèi)容:每日四文,一篇函數(shù)教程、一篇VBA教程、一個(gè)短視頻小技巧、一篇雜文。

收錄于話題
每天一篇Excel技術(shù)圖文
微信公眾號(hào):Excel星球
NO.1111-觸摸屏函數(shù)

作者:看見(jiàn)星光
 微博:EXCELers / 知識(shí)星球:Excel

HI,大家好,我是星光。
上一期推文給大家介紹了 HYPERLINK 函數(shù)的語(yǔ)法和用法,末尾留了個(gè)小尾巴
……HYPERLINK是工作表函數(shù)中唯一的 觸摸屏函數(shù) ;當(dāng)我們將鼠標(biāo)放在它所返回的字符串上時(shí),它就已經(jīng)處于半運(yùn)行狀態(tài)了。雖然不會(huì)立刻跳轉(zhuǎn)到指定地址,但會(huì)自動(dòng)更新地址參數(shù)。利用這個(gè)特點(diǎn),我們可以制作觸摸屏性質(zhì)的交互圖表。
這期就給大家分享一下如何制作這種觸摸屏性質(zhì)的交互圖表,當(dāng)鼠標(biāo)滑過(guò)產(chǎn)品名稱,即可使圖表動(dòng)態(tài)更新。
?    準(zhǔn)備一份數(shù)據(jù)源。
嚴(yán)肅臉聲明一下,在下祖上三代都在祖國(guó)北方種植糧食產(chǎn)物,從不搞軍火生意,以上數(shù)據(jù)是某玩具廠的虛擬銷售數(shù)據(jù),Thanks?(?ω?)?
?   計(jì)算展示數(shù)據(jù)
在G1單元格輸入任意產(chǎn)品的名字,比如飛機(jī)。
在G2單元格輸入以下公式,并向下復(fù)制填充:
=HLOOKUP($G$1,$A$1:$E$23,ROW(A2),0)
公式的作用是根據(jù)G1的產(chǎn)品名稱查詢各個(gè)月份的銷售數(shù)據(jù)。
?   創(chuàng)建圖表
選中G2:G10區(qū)域,創(chuàng)建柱形圖,調(diào)整縱橫坐標(biāo),制作動(dòng)態(tài)標(biāo)題,依照個(gè)人品味稍加美化。
?   讓圖表動(dòng)起來(lái)
打開(kāi)VBE編輯器,新建一個(gè)模塊,復(fù)制粘貼以下代碼:
Function abc(rng As Range)
    Range("g1").Value = rng.Value
End Function
這是一個(gè)自定義函數(shù),只有一個(gè)參數(shù),它可以將 G1單元格的值 設(shè)置為參數(shù)值。
在I16單元格輸入函數(shù)公式如下:
=IFERROR( HYPERLINK(abc(B1)) ,B1&REPT(" ",99))
HYPERLINK(ABC(B1))部分,會(huì)返回一個(gè)錯(cuò)誤值; 但它返回啥并不重要 。我們只是借助HYPERLINK觸摸屏運(yùn)算的機(jī)制,當(dāng)鼠標(biāo)滑過(guò)它時(shí),自動(dòng)運(yùn)算它的第一參數(shù),也就是abc(B1)。abc是我們前面設(shè)置的自定義函數(shù),它會(huì)將B1的值寫入G1單元格,也就是將G1的值修改為飛機(jī)。
B1&REPT(" ",99) 部分,借助IFERROR函數(shù)容錯(cuò)的特性,返回B1單元格的值+99個(gè)空格。數(shù)量如此眾多的空格,是為了在凌晨就將單元格孤寂的欲望填滿。當(dāng)鼠標(biāo)滑過(guò)單元格,即可觸發(fā)HYPERLINK運(yùn)算。
以同樣的方式設(shè)置I17/I18/I19單元格,相關(guān)公式如下:
=IFERROR( HYPERLINK(abc(C1)) ,C1&REPT(" ",99))
=IFERROR( HYPERLINK(abc(D1)) ,E1&REPT(" ",99))
=IFERROR( HYPERLINK(abc(E1)) ,E1&REPT(" ",99))
如此一個(gè)簡(jiǎn)單的觸摸屏交互圖表就制作完成了。再看一眼,然后文末下載案例文件動(dòng)手試一下吧。
案例文件下載百度網(wǎng)盤:
https://pan.baidu.com/s/17HVRtBHliQZLKBtuKO5e-A 
提取碼: e6vh
蓋木歐瓦,有啥問(wèn)題可在VIP會(huì)員群中提問(wèn)交流。左上角點(diǎn)個(gè)贊,右下角點(diǎn)關(guān)注,咱們明天再見(jiàn)。

加入我的Excel會(huì)員, 全面學(xué)習(xí)Excel
透視表 函數(shù) 圖表 VBA PQ想學(xué)啥學(xué)啥

本文由公眾號(hào)“Excel星球”首發(fā)。

點(diǎn)擊 閱讀原文 ,加入Excel會(huì)員社群!

版權(quán):如無(wú)特殊注明,文章轉(zhuǎn)載自網(wǎng)絡(luò),侵權(quán)請(qǐng)聯(lián)系cnmhg168#163.com刪除!文件均為網(wǎng)友上傳,僅供研究和學(xué)習(xí)使用,務(wù)必24小時(shí)內(nèi)刪除。
相關(guān)推薦